Can A Limb Lengthening Procedure Infect A Previously Placed Jawline Implant?
Q: Dr. Eppley, I’d like to ask you a question.This year I’ll do an Ilizarov surgery to lengthen my right leg. I know that Ilizarov could cause infection, but you can cure it with antibiotics. If I get from you a custom wrap around jawline implant fBEFORE the Ilizarov treatment could an Ilizarov infection cause the infection to spread to the jawline implant?
Thank you so much
A: I know of no infectious correlation between a jawline implant and a lower extremity device procedure regardless of the order in which they are performed. Specifically do I think that a bone infection from limb lengthening procedure could cause a delayed infection in a well healed previously placed jawline implant…I think that would be very unlikely.
